The Essential Guide To E-Learning Courseware Development

In today’s digital age, e-learning has become an integral part of education and training With the rise of remote work and online learning, the demand for effective e-learning courseware development has never been higher E-learning courseware development refers to the process of creating digital learning materials, such as online courses, modules, and interactive multimedia content, to deliver educational or training materials to learners through the internet This article will explore the key components of e-learning courseware development and provide tips for creating engaging and effective digital learning experiences.

One of the most important aspects of e-learning courseware development is understanding the needs and goals of the learners Before beginning the development process, it is essential to conduct a thorough needs analysis to identify the target audience, their learning objectives, and any specific requirements they may have By gaining a deep understanding of the learners’ needs, developers can tailor the courseware to meet those needs and provide a more engaging and effective learning experience.

Next, e-learning developers should carefully consider the content and structure of the courseware The content should be relevant, up-to-date, and engaging to keep learners interested and motivated It is essential to present information in a clear and concise manner, using multimedia elements such as videos, animations, and interactive simulations to enhance the learning experience The structure of the courseware should be logical and easy to navigate, allowing learners to progress through the material at their own pace.

Another key aspect of e-learning courseware development is incorporating interactivity and engagement Interactive elements such as quizzes, discussions, and simulations can help to reinforce learning and keep learners actively involved in the course By encouraging participation and collaboration, developers can create a more dynamic and engaging learning experience that is more likely to lead to better retention and comprehension of the material.

The courseware should be designed with the needs of all learners in mind, including those with disabilities or learning challenges Developers should ensure that the courseware is easy to navigate, with clear instructions and intuitive controls It is also important to consider factors such as screen reader compatibility, keyboard navigation, and alternative formats for those with visual or auditory impairments.

Furthermore, e-learning courseware development should be backed by a robust assessment and feedback system Assessments such as quizzes, exams, and assignments can help to gauge learners’ understanding of the material and provide valuable feedback for both learners and instructors Feedback mechanisms such as surveys and evaluations can also help to improve the courseware over time by identifying areas for improvement and gathering input from learners on their experiences.

As technology continues to evolve, e-learning courseware development must also adapt to keep pace with changing trends and innovations Developers should stay informed about the latest tools and technologies in e-learning, such as mobile learning, gamification, and virtual reality, and consider how these can be integrated into their courseware to enhance the learning experience By staying ahead of the curve and incorporating cutting-edge technologies, developers can create more engaging and effective e-learning experiences that meet the needs of modern learners.

In conclusion, e-learning courseware development is a critical component of modern education and training, providing learners with flexible and engaging digital learning experiences By understanding the needs and goals of learners, creating relevant and engaging content, incorporating interactive elements, ensuring accessibility and usability, and implementing robust assessment and feedback systems, developers can create effective e-learning courseware that meets the needs of today’s learners By staying informed about the latest trends and technologies in e-learning, developers can continue to innovate and improve the quality of digital learning experiences for learners around the world.
